Approaches Jacqueline Hueyopa Uses and How Online Therapy Fits

Jacqueline Hueyopa draws on Acceptance and Commitment Therapy, Attachment-Based Therapy, and Cognitive Behavioral Therapy to guide her work.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T) helps clients notice difficult thoughts and feelings without getting stuck in them, and it focuses on identifying personal values and taking committed action toward those values. Attachment-Based Therapy explores patterns formed in early relationships to help people understand how those patterns affect current connections and emotional responses.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) focuses on identifying and shifting unhelpful thoughts and behaviors to reduce symptoms and improve daily functioning.
